The government will start administering the second dose of the Covid-19 mass vaccination drive from September 7.

Directorate General of Health Services chief Professor Dr Abul Bashar Mohammad Khurshid Alam made the announcement at a programme at Central Medical Stores Depot (CMSD) on Wednesday.

Mentioning that more vaccines will arrive before second dose campaign starts, he said there will be no problems arranging the second dose. 

“We have 3.5 million shots in hand and another 5 million Sinopharm vaccines will arrive on 30 August, which will be enough to vaccinate them all,” he said.

The government rolled out the countrywide Covid vaccination drive on August 7 to bring the people at the union level under the immunisation coverage in a short time.
